Transaction 34bc1abdb7f10ee26b9af960b91bf35436c24742270b2878ded4312b9129ae4c
1 Input
2 Outputs
- 34bc1abdb7f10ee26b9af960b91bf35436c24742270b2878ded4312b9129ae4c:0
- 34bc1abdb7f10ee26b9af960b91bf35436c24742270b2878ded4312b9129ae4c:1
value 46069
address 3Gyq1HejuLiL5hT3CpFPrY5QiQ1Y24BkaW
value 335176
address 121eDvWGVtEAZwQT2Rw8VocsMQTVtRahUj